About the Class

Let's learn some really interesting new words and expressions from the latest edition of the New Oxford American Dictionary!

Level: Pre-Intermediate to Intermediate.

All welcome! :o)

Language of instruction: English

Matt Purland is a lecturer in English Language. He has a BA Honours degree in Drama from the University of Wales and a Postgraduate Certificate in Further Education from the University of Derby. In 2002 he launched English Banana.com, which has become a hugely popular English language learning resource website (see above for more info).
